Emily Fowke , Poss.. Merthyr Telegraph, and General Advertiser For the Iron Districts of South Wales. 6 December 1862 BASTARDY. Emily Fowke of Tredegar summoned John Price, late of Tredegar, parish constable, but now of Newport, County Court bailiff, to show cause why an affiliation order should not be made against him in con- sequence of his being the father of her child, but neither parties appearing the complaint was dismissed. Merthyr Telegraph, and General Advertiser for the Iron Districts of South Wales 21 February 1863 child was born 25th?/29th? Sep 1862. She lives at Brynbicha between Tredegar and Ebbw Vale. John Price lives in Tredegar and is a county court bailiff at Newport She had previously had a child who was dead by this time. The case was not dismissed. He was to pay 1s 6d a week and costs.
